What we know : Name William Urguhart Regiment or Unit Name 42nd Regiment of Foot 2nd Battalion He joined ther army at age 18 as an Ensign on the 20th Feb 1812. Although enlisted for to the First Battalion, he also served with the 2nd Battalion. He was promoted to 1st Lieutenant on the 5th Jan 1814. Seriously wounded in the battle of Toulouse

He left the military (due to wounds) near the end of 1814 His pension examination date is 18 Mar 1818 which presumably is about the time of formal discharge from army.

Daughter JOHANNA SCOBIE baptized 20 Nov 1818 in Unapool, lawful daughter to William urquhart & Anne Isto Pensioner in Unapool

Daughter Anne born Jan 24th1822, baptized 1st of Feb recorded as a Pensioner (Retired Soldier) in Thrumster (settlement near Wick) by his wife Anne Esto, witness Steven Miller in Thrumster and David Roberson looper in Sarclet.

John Urquhart son was born about 1824 in Sarclet according to several Census, this is consistent with Anne's birth location.

His wife Anne is with John and family on the 1861 Census - William is presumably dead by then, another daughter Jessie born about 1831 shows in the Census. There is doubt over where William was born, census record says Assynt, Wick area may also be possible

Biography

William was born in 1794. Served in the 42nd Regiment of Foot, and saw action in Bordeaux area Wounded at the Battle of Toulouse.
